Introduction to Microneedle Stamps
Microneedle stamps are small, handheld devices used in the field of skincare and aesthetics. They have tiny needles that create micro-injuries on the skin’s surface, stimulating collagen production and promoting skin regeneration. This process can help reduce fine lines, wrinkles, and acne scars, leaving the skin looking smoother and more even-toned.
The concept of microneedle stamps is based on the principle of micro-injury, where the tiny needles puncture the skin and trigger a healing response. As the skin heals, it produces new collagen and elastin, which are essential proteins for maintaining skin elasticity and firmness. Microneedle stamps are often used in conjunction with other skincare treatments, such as serums and creams, to enhance their absorption and effectiveness.
Microneedle stamps are available in various sizes and needle lengths, making them suitable for different skin types and concerns. They can be used on the face, neck, and body, and are particularly effective in targeting areas with fine lines, wrinkles, and skin texture irregularities. When used correctly, microneedle stamps can be a safe and effective way to achieve healthier, more radiant-looking skin.

How to Choose the Right Microneedle Stamp
Choosing the right microneedle stamp can be a daunting task, especially for those who are new to the world of microneedling. With so many different options available on the market, it’s essential to consider a few key factors before making a purchase. First and foremost, consider the size of the microneedle stamp. Microneedle stamps come in a variety of sizes, ranging from small, portable devices to larger, more extensive systems. The size of the stamp will depend on the area of skin you’re looking to treat, as well as your personal preference.
Another important factor to consider is the length of the needles. Microneedle stamps typically have needles that range in length from 0.5mm to 2.5mm. The length of the needles will depend on the depth of penetration you’re looking to achieve, as well as the sensitivity of your skin. For example, if you’re looking to treat fine lines and wrinkles, you may want to opt for a stamp with shorter needles. On the other hand, if you’re looking to treat deeper scars or skin concerns, you may want to opt for a stamp with longer needles.
In addition to the size and needle length, it’s also essential to consider the material of the microneedle stamp. Microneedle stamps can be made from a variety of materials, including stainless steel, titanium, and plastic. Each material has its own unique benefits and drawbacks, and the right material for you will depend on your personal preference and skin type. For example, stainless steel microneedle stamps are often preferred for their durability and ease of cleaning, while titanium stamps are often preferred for their lightweight design and corrosion-resistant properties.

Microneedle Stamp Safety and Precautions
While microneedle stamps can be a highly effective treatment option for a variety of skin concerns, they do require some safety precautions and considerations. One of the most important things to consider is the risk of infection. Microneedle stamps can create micro-injuries on the skin, which can increase the risk of infection if not properly cleaned and maintained. To minimize this risk, it’s essential to clean and disinfect the stamp regularly, and to use a new stamp for each treatment.
Another important consideration is the risk of allergic reactions. Some individuals may be allergic to certain materials used in microneedle stamps, such as nickel or latex. If you have a history of allergies, it’s essential to choose a stamp made from hypoallergenic materials and to do a patch test before using the stamp on a larger area of skin. Additionally, if you experience any redness, itching, or swelling after using a microneedle stamp, discontinue use and consult with a healthcare professional.
In addition to these precautions, it’s also essential to consider the risk of over-treatment. Microneedle stamps can be intense, and over-treating the skin can lead to irritation, dryness, and other adverse effects. To minimize this risk, it’s essential to start with a low intensity and gradually increase as needed. It’s also essential to follow a consistent treatment schedule and to give the skin time to recover between treatments. By taking these precautions and considering these risks, you can minimize the potential for adverse effects and achieve the best possible results from your microneedle stamp.
It’s also important to note that microneedle stamps are not suitable for everyone. Individuals with certain skin conditions, such as active acne, rosacea, or eczema, may need to avoid using microneedle stamps or take special precautions to minimize the risk of adverse effects. Additionally, individuals who are pregnant or breastfeeding may need to consult with a healthcare professional before using a microneedle stamp. By taking these precautions and considering these risks, you can ensure a safe and effective treatment experience with your microneedle stamp.

Needle Depth and Density
The depth and density of the needles on a microneedle stamp are critical factors to consider, as they can affect the performance and safety of the product. The depth of the needles will determine how deeply they penetrate the skin, which can impact the effectiveness of the treatment. Deeper needles may be more effective for certain applications, such as scar treatment or deep wrinkles, but they can also increase the risk of bleeding, bruising, and other complications. The density of the needles, on the other hand, will determine how many punctures are made in the skin with each stamp, which can impact the overall coverage and effectiveness of the treatment.
The ideal needle depth and density will depend on the specific application and the individual’s skin type and concerns. For example, a microneedle stamp with shorter, less dense needles may be more suitable for sensitive skin or for treating fine lines and wrinkles. A stamp with deeper, more dense needles may be more effective for treating scars, stretch marks, or deeper wrinkles. When choosing a microneedle stamp, it’s essential to consider the specific needs and concerns of the individual, as well as the recommended treatment protocol for the desired application.

How often should I use a microneedle stamp?
The frequency of use for a microneedle stamp will depend on your individual skin concerns and goals. For most people, using a microneedle stamp once or twice a week is sufficient to see noticeable improvements in the skin. However, if you have more pronounced skin concerns, such as deep wrinkles or acne scars, you may need to use the microneedle stamp more frequently, such as every 3-4 days.
It’s essential to note that overusing a microneedle stamp can lead to irritation, inflammation, and other complications. To avoid this, start with a lower frequency of use and gradually increase as needed. It’s also important to follow a consistent skincare routine and use the microneedle stamp in conjunction with other skincare products, such as serums and moisturizers, to enhance its effectiveness. By using the microneedle stamp consistently and as directed, you can achieve optimal results and enjoy healthier, more radiant-looking skin.
